Hello Rohan, unfortunately there is no committer working on this project, me being an exception with overseeing this lists. The problem is the original creators of this code are gone and so far we were not able to identify people who are willing to carry on. Before a while we have discussed how to proceed with this project. While it seems there is a user base it also seems there is no one willing to actually invest the time and for example deal with releasing this project. If there are such people, I would support moving the project to the Apache Incubator (incubator.apache.org) and help folks to learn about our procedures. Of course with the goal in mind to come back to logging.apache.org finally.
